计算型和通用型服务器适合哪些应用场景?

计算型和通用型服务器是云服务(如阿里云、腾讯云、AWS等)和传统IDC中常见的实例类型分类,其核心差异在于硬件资源配置的侧重点不同,从而适配不同的工作负载特征。以下是它们的典型应用场景对比分析:

✅ 一、计算型服务器(Compute-Optimized)

特点

  • 高CPU/内存比(如 CPU:RAM ≈ 1:2 或更高,部分型号达 1:1.5)
  • 搭载高性能处理器(如 Intel Xeon Platinum / AMD EPYC 最新款,支持高主频、多核超线程)
  • 通常配备较强单核性能或高并发计算能力,部分支持GPU/FPGA提速(但非标配)
  • 网络与存储IO为中高端配置(满足计算密集任务的数据吞吐需求)
🔹 典型应用场景 场景 说明 示例
科学计算与仿真 需大量浮点运算、矩阵求解、并行迭代 CFD流体仿真、分子动力学模拟、气象建模、CAE结构分析
高性能Web/APP后端服务 高并发、低延迟、逻辑复杂的服务端(非IO瓶颈) 大型电商秒杀系统、实时推荐引擎、X_X高频交易中间件
批处理与离线计算 CPU密集型ETL、视频转码、渲染、代码编译 视频批量转码(H.265)、3D动画渲染(Maya/Blender)、CI/CD构建集群
AI模型训练(中小规模) 训练轻量级模型(如BERT-base、YOLOv5)或分布式训练中的Worker节点 NLP文本分类训练、CV目标检测模型调优(非千亿参数级别)
游戏服务器(逻辑服/战斗服) 实时性要求高、每帧需大量状态计算 MOBA/MMO游戏的世界逻辑服、战斗匹配与结算服务

⚠️ 注意:若需大规模AI训练或图形渲染,应优先选择GPU计算型(如gn7/gn10x)或异构计算型,而非纯CPU计算型。

✅ 二、通用型服务器(General-Purpose)

特点

  • CPU与内存配比均衡(常见 1:4 或 1:8,如 4核16GB、8核32GB)
  • 平衡的网络带宽、存储IOPS与CPU性能
  • 成本效益高,适合大多数常规业务负载
  • 通常支持突发性能(如T系列)或稳定基准性能(如G系列)
🔹 典型应用场景 场景 说明 示例
企业级Web应用与门户网站 中低并发、数据库+应用分离架构,对响应时间敏感但非极致 CMS内容管理系统、OA/ERP系统前端、X_X/教育官网
中小型数据库服务 MySQL/PostgreSQL/SQL Server(中小数据量,QPS < 5k) 业务订单库、用户信息库、日志分析平台元数据库
微服务与容器化平台(K8s Node) 多个中等资源消耗的Pod共存,需资源弹性与稳定性 Spring Cloud微服务集群、Docker Swarm节点、DevOps流水线Agent
开发测试环境 & CI/CD 需要灵活启停、成本可控、兼顾编译与运行需求 Jenkins构建机、测试环境部署、自动化回归测试集群
轻量级缓存与消息中间件 Redis(<20GB)、RabbitMQ/Kafka(中小集群) 用户会话缓存、API限流计数器、内部通知队列

📌 补充说明:

  • “通用型”不等于“低端”:现代通用型(如阿里云g8i、AWS m6i)已采用最新代CPU(Ice Lake/Genoa),性能强劲,是生产环境主力机型。
  • 选型建议
    • 先明确瓶颈维度:是CPU持续满载?内存频繁swap?磁盘IO等待高?网络带宽打满?
    • 使用监控工具(如CloudWatch、Zabbix、Prometheus)观察历史负载曲线(CPU利用率 >70%持续15min?内存使用率 >90%?)
    • 对于数据库类应用,内存往往比CPU更关键 → 通用型常更合适;而渲染/仿真类,CPU核数与主频是首要指标 → 计算型更优。

✅ 总结一句话:

计算型 = “算得快”,适合CPU是瓶颈的场景;
通用型 = “稳得住、配得当”,适合CPU/内存/IO相对均衡、追求综合性价比的主流业务。

如需进一步选型建议,可提供您的具体业务(如:“日活50万的社交App后端,含IM消息+Feed流生成+图片压缩”),我可以帮您匹配推荐实例规格及架构优化方向。